Could anyone tell me what they use for Bituminous Coated Corrugated Metal Pipe (BCCMP) manning's n value? Please include your reference if you have one handy. Thank you much.
 
same as regular CMP - generally accepted as 0.024
 
Depends if it's spiral or annular.
 
cvg or dicksewerrat.... do you happen to have any widely used reference manual for this information? My bently stormwater manual does not show BCCMP. I appreciate the responses.
 
just use your reference for normal cmp. the coating does not have a significant effect on the roughness
